Abstract: (Elsevier)
Using the non-linear effective lagrangian technique, we show explicitly that only derivative coupling is allowed for the K - π, K → 2π and K → 3π transitions induced by the ΔS = 1 Penguin operator of SVZ in agreement with chiral symmetry requirements. From a derivative coupling (3, 3 ) mass term and the SU(3) breaking effect for ƒ K /ƒ π , we estimate the strength of the Penguin interactions and find it too small to account for the ΔI = 1 2 amplitude.
